USAGE INSTRUCTIONS
“Dry” Cleaning with the QbE
®
1. Pull one
QbE
®
Wipe over the fiber-safe
foam platen.
2. Hold the end face at a 90 degree
perpendicular to the platen.
3. Draw the end face lightly over the platen in a
smooth linear motion - do not press too hard.
4. Do not retrace your cleaning procedure in the
same area.
5. Do not use a figure-eight motion; do not use
a “twist & turn” motion.
6. Check your work with a fiber scope or
measuring device.
“Wet” Cleaning with the QbE
®
ith the QbE
1. Lightly “spot” the
QbE
®
wipe on the platen
with Electro-Wash
®
PX Fiber Optic Cleaner.
2. Draw the end-face from the solvent wetted
area to the dry area.
3. Check your work with a fiber scope or
measuring device.
For Splice Preparation
1. Lightly moisten
QbE
®
wipe and gently
wipe away fiber contaminants.
2. Lightly dampen a 38540ESD swab,
remove soil from V-grooves on fusion
splicer.
Buffer Gel Removal
Buffer Gel Removal
1. Pull three single
QbE
®
Wipers out of the
container.
2. Spray a small amount of Electro-Wash
®
PX Fiber Optic Cleaner into the folded
wipers.
3. Pull the cable through the first wiper and
discard.
4. Repeat until the cable “squeaks” clean.
